/lʌmp/ English

Definitions

noun

  1. Something that protrudes, sticks out, or sticks together; a cluster or blob; a mound or mass of no particular shape.“Stir the gravy until there are no more lumps.”
  2. A group, set, or unit.“The money arrived all at once as one big lump sum payment.”
  3. A small, shaped mass of sugar, typically about a teaspoonful.“Do you want one lump or two with your coffee?”
  4. A dull or lazy person.“Don't just sit there like a lump.”

verb

  1. To treat as a single unit; to group together in a casual or chaotic manner (as if forming an ill-defined lump of the items).“People tend to lump turtles and tortoises together, when in fact they are different creatures.”
  2. To bear a heavy or awkward burden; to carry something unwieldy from one place to another.
  3. To hit or strike (a person).
